Marian Lupu: I don’t want to put my colleagues in a delicate situation

The members of the ruling alliance did not react to the Democratic leader Marian Lupu’s call to convene the meeting of the AEI to consider strengthening the political forces after the June 5 local elections. “We still have time, but we should not avoid meeting after June 5. Until today, we have not exchanged opinions. I believe that my colleagues had field trips, as I had,” Marian Lupu said Wednesday, quoted by Info-Prim Neo. He reiterated that the proposal to hold a meeting of the AEI to discuss post-election strategies was put forward after he met with representatives of a number of EU member states. “It was not an invitation. I expressed my position after I discussed with leaders of EU member states, who follow attentively the election campaign and the local elections in Moldova. This thing inspired me to say that we should meet before June 5 and discuss our post-election strategies. I don’t want to put my colleagues in a delicate situation. That’s why I said that I only expressed my stance,” Marian Lupu said. In a press briefing earlier this week, the head of the Democratic Party called on the colleagues from the AEI to come together and consider the steps that should be taken after June 5.
